Meet Our Team
Our team consists of KNZB/ENVOZ certified swimming instructors in Amsterdam, all regularly trained, aligned with our safety-first, student-centred approach, and care about creating lessons where children and adults feel seen, supported, and confident in the water.

Ellen
Swimming Instructor
I was a competitive swimmer until the age of 18. I trained every day, and despite the intensity, I loved it.
What I enjoy most about teaching is working with children and their spontaneity—seeing them grow and gain self-confidence. I have been doing this with pleasure for over 20 years. My motto is: if you no longer enjoy it, you should stop, because otherwise you can't truly teach children—they can feel it when you no longer enjoy what you do. And when they stand there with their diploma, I am proud of what they have achieved.

Hatice
Swimming Instructor
Teaching swimming turned out to be my calling. It has been deeply healing for me.
I personally started at the age of 33 with Level 1, and one year later—after completing the ABC diplomas—I began teaching as an assistant instructor. After 26 years of teaching, I still teach with passion and love. Every lesson, I look through the eyes of my students, and it always feels new and exciting. When I can no longer do that (or because of old age 😅), I will stop teaching.
